We would like to invite your team to participate in the 15th annual VS Athletics APU Meet Of Champions Distance Classic sponsored by VS Athletics, Azusa Pacific University, and Arroyo High School to be held on Saturday, March 22, 2008, on the beautiful Azusa Pacific University all-weather facility.

Our purpose, as always, remains to provide all of your distance runners from the elite runner to the absolute beginner a chance to race against competition that is of equal ability on a world class facility with a world class sponsor for a beautiful custom designed medal.

For your elite runners this meet will give them the opportunity to get fast qualifying times for both the Arcadia and the Mt. Sac Invitationals.

The meet will have the 400, 800, 1600, and 3200 events.

This year we will be attempting to break our own world record set last year of most boys under 5:00 and most girls under 6:00 in the 1600 meters.

Our current world records are….
Boys - 224 under 5:00
Girls - 185 under 6:00

Seeding: Each race will be seeded by the times entered on the entry form. The number of races will be determined at the Clerk of the Course on the day of the meet. Every runner will get a chance to compete for medals.
-There will be 8 runners in each 400 heat up through heat 8.(Heats 9 and up will have 10-12 runners running from a scratch start)
-There will be approximately 12-14 runners in each 800 heat.
-There will be approximately 12-18 runners in each 1600 heat.
-There will be approximately 16-22 runners in each 3200 heat.
Awards: Each race is a final and medals will be awarded for each race.
  In the 400 meter races 1-4 medal
  In the 800 and 1600 1-6 medal
  In the 3200 1-8 medal
  * We always increase the number of medals if we create larger fields. Most of the time we medal approximately just less than half the field.
